<title>sdcard_image-rpi.bbclass: drop KERNEL_INITRAMFS variable</title>

* use INITRAMFS_SYMLINK_NAME from new kernel-artifact-names.bbclass
  instead of KERNEL_INITRAMFS
* the documentation says that KERNEL_INITRAMFS should be used to
  define extension of initramfs, but in linux-raspberrypi.inc it's
  defined only to 1 or empty based on INITRAMFS_IMAGE_BUNDLE variable
  and I don't see any code in meta-raspberry or oe-core which would
  use KERNEL_INITRAMFS to actualy name the initramfs artifact to create:
  ${DEPLOY_DIR_IMAGE}/${KERNEL_IMAGETYPE}${KERNEL_INITRAMFS}-${MACHINE}.bin
  used in classes/sdcard_image-rpi.bbclass
* also fix the assumption that there is -${MACHINE} suffix in:
  ${DEPLOY_DIR_IMAGE}/${KERNEL_IMAGETYPE}${KERNEL_INITRAMFS}-${MACHINE}.bin
  because that's defined as KERNEL_IMAGE_SYMLINK_NAME and some DISTROs
  might use different value

<title>linux-firmware: restore and merge bluez-firmware</title>

The attempt to Raspbian updated firmware blobs in packages separate from
linux-firmware introduced unresolvable conflicts with the standard
linux-firmware roll-up package.  Revert to using an augmented
linux-firmware recipe that overrides and adds firmware from two Raspbian
repositories that have up-to-date images.
